[Objective] To investigate the flavonoids in the leaves of Rhododendron pulchrum sweet by high performance liquid chromatograph - electrospray ionization tandem mass spectrometry. [Method]The chromatographic separation was performed on a C18column ( 4. 6 mm × 250 mm,5 μm) . The mobile phase A waswater containing 0. 1% formic acid and mobile phase B was anhydrous methanol. Gradient eluted program was: 0 - 24 min,31% - 42% B; 24 - 30 min,42% -50% B; 30 - 35 min,50% - 60% B; 35 - 40 min,60% B. Injection volume was 20 μl; flow rate was 0. 7 ml / min; column temperature was 30 ℃ ; and detectionwavelength was 356 nm. Mass spectrometer conditions were ESI,anion mode scanning,drying gas temperature 350 ℃ ,drying gas volume flow ( N2) 10 L/min,nebulizing gas pressure 275. 8 KPa,capillary voltage 3. 5 kV,capillary export voltage 100 V,and mass scan range m / z 200 - 700. Data were collected in anionmode. [Result] Compared with the standard references and literature data,five flavonoids compounds were identified as hyperoside,isoquercitrin,avicularin,quercitroside and quercetin. [Conclusion]This method was rapid,accurate and effective which could be applied for the constituent identification of R. pulchrum,and provided theoretical basis for the application of R. pulchrum.
